2. Invest in Quality Paper: To make the most of your Tonic Studios Alcohol Markers, invest in high-quality marker paper or a smooth, heavyweight cardstock. These papers are designed to prevent bleeding and feathering, ensuring that your colors stay sharp and vibrant.
3. Start with Basic Blending: If you're new to alcohol markers, start with basic blending techniques. Choose two or three colors that complement each other and practice creating smooth transitions from one color to another. The alcohol-based ink of Tonic Studios markers makes blending a breeze.
4. The Magic of Layering: One of the standout features of alcohol markers is their ability to layer colors. Build depth and dimension in your artwork by applying multiple layers of color. Remember to let each layer dry before adding the next one for the best results.
5. Experiment with Different Strokes: Play around with various stroke techniques to achieve different effects. Try flicking, stippling, or cross-hatching to add texture and interest to your artwork.
6. Embrace the Colorless Blender: Tonic Studios Alcohol Markers often come with a colorless blender pen. This pen can be your best friend when it comes to correcting mistakes, creating highlights, or pushing color around on the paper.
7. Keep Your Workspace Well-Ventilated: Alcohol markers have a strong odor, so make sure your workspace is well-ventilated to avoid inhaling fumes. Working near an open window or using a dedicated marker ventilation system is advisable.
8. Protect Your Surfaces: To prevent ink from bleeding through your paper and onto your working surface, place a protective sheet or scrap paper under your artwork.
